How to Use Baking Soda to Remove Spots, Wrinkles, and Dark Circles from the Face

Ingredients

  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 tablespoon water (or rose water for extra benefits)
  • 1/2 teaspoon honey (optional, for moisturizing)
  • 1 drop vitamin E oil (optional, for nourishment)

Instructions

  1. Mix the Ingredients – In a small bowl, combine baking soda with water (or rose water) to form a smooth paste. Add honey and vitamin E oil if desired.
  2. Apply to the Face – Gently massage the mixture onto the affected areas (spots, wrinkles, or dark circles) using circular motions. Avoid getting too close to the eyes.
  3. Let It Sit – Leave the mixture on your skin for 5–10 minutes. If you have sensitive skin, rinse after 5 minutes to avoid irritation.
  4. Rinse Thoroughly – Use lukewarm water to rinse off the paste, then pat your skin dry with a soft towel.
  5. Moisturize – Apply a gentle moisturizer or aloe vera gel to keep your skin hydrated.
  6. Repeat – Use this remedy 2–3 times a week for best results.

🌿 Tip: Always do a patch test before applying to your face, as baking soda may be too strong for some skin types!
